Webx系列之创建Webx工程
系列 创建 工程
2023-09-11 14:16:04 时间
本文参考文章为Webx官方说明文档。网址在此:http://www.openwebx.org/docs/firstapp.html
准备工作
安装JDK
WebX需要JDK1.5以上的版本。JDK的下载及安装请自行百度。
安装和配置Maven
Webx需要Maven2及以上版本。下载
![](http://img.blog.csdn.net/20160508214642086?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
,搜索:![](http://img.blog.csdn.net/20160508214735025?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
创建Webx应用
Win+R打开cmd命令,输入一下内容:mvn archetype:generate -DgroupId=com.alibaba.webx -DartifactId=WebxTest -Dversion=1.0-SNAPSHOT -Dpackage=com.alibaba.webx.webxtest -DarchetypeArtifactId=archetype-webx-quickstart -DarchetypeGroupId=com.alibaba.citrus.sample
-DarchetypeVersion=1.8 -DinteractiveMode=false 然后,Enter,OK一个Webx项目就创建完成了。
命令说明: -DgroupId=com.alibaba.webx 项目组 -DartifactId=WebxTest 项目名称(可以改成你想要的项目名称) -Dversion=1.0-SNAPSHOT 项目版本 -Dpackage=com.alibaba.webx.WebxTest 项目中java类的包名 进入你刚才创建的WebxTest目录下面,然后输入一下命令:mvn jetty:run或者mvn tomcat:run。分别是启动Jetty服务器和TomCat服务器。Jetty服务器默认端口是8081,TomCat默认端口号是8080.
SpringBoot2.x整合体系(HelloWorld工程) SSM框架对于新手来说,往往死在配置,有时候你会发现即使按照教程一步一步走,最后还是会出错。Springboot的出现极大的解决了这个问题。本系列文章非教程文档,只是给大家提供一个完整的教程案例。概念问题建议自学。Springboot相关的教程或者是书籍已经非常多了。
启动类加载器 (Bootstrap ClassLoader) 是 Java 类加载层次中最顶层的类加载器,负责加载 JDK 中的核心类库,如:rt.jar、resources.jar、charsets.jar 等 扩展类加载器(Extension ClassLoader) 负责加载 Java 的扩展类库,默认加载 JAVA_HOME/jre/lib/ext/目下的所有 jar 应用类加载器(Application ClassLoader) 负责加载应用程序 classpath 目录下的所有 jar 和 class 文件。
本文参考文章为Webx官方说明文档。网址在此:http://www.openwebx.org/docs/firstapp.html
准备工作 安装JDK WebX需要JDK1.5以上的版本。JDK的下载及安装请自行百度。 安装和配置Maven Webx需要Maven2及以上版本。下载地址如下::http://maven.apache.org/。免安装版,你只需要配置一些环境变量即可。 Webx在很大程度上是依赖于SpringEXT的,所以你需要在你的IDE中安装SpringEXT这个插件。目前我发现在Eclipse、Spring Tool Suite中是可以安装这个插件的。Idea、MyEclipse目前还安装不了。安装步骤如图:命令说明: -DgroupId=com.alibaba.webx 项目组 -DartifactId=WebxTest 项目名称(可以改成你想要的项目名称) -Dversion=1.0-SNAPSHOT 项目版本 -Dpackage=com.alibaba.webx.WebxTest 项目中java类的包名 进入你刚才创建的WebxTest目录下面,然后输入一下命令:mvn jetty:run或者mvn tomcat:run。分别是启动Jetty服务器和TomCat服务器。Jetty服务器默认端口是8081,TomCat默认端口号是8080.
SpringBoot2.x整合体系(HelloWorld工程) SSM框架对于新手来说,往往死在配置,有时候你会发现即使按照教程一步一步走,最后还是会出错。Springboot的出现极大的解决了这个问题。本系列文章非教程文档,只是给大家提供一个完整的教程案例。概念问题建议自学。Springboot相关的教程或者是书籍已经非常多了。
启动类加载器 (Bootstrap ClassLoader) 是 Java 类加载层次中最顶层的类加载器,负责加载 JDK 中的核心类库,如:rt.jar、resources.jar、charsets.jar 等 扩展类加载器(Extension ClassLoader) 负责加载 Java 的扩展类库,默认加载 JAVA_HOME/jre/lib/ext/目下的所有 jar 应用类加载器(Application ClassLoader) 负责加载应用程序 classpath 目录下的所有 jar 和 class 文件。
相关文章
- 使用 ASP.NET Core MVC 创建 Web API 系列文章目录
- Numpy库速通教程典藏版 #一篇就够了系列
- dart系列之:创建Library package
- netty系列之:在netty中使用proxy protocol
- (《机器学习》完整版系列)第16章 强化学习——16.10 值函数近似
- openssl之BIO系列之9---BIO对的创建和应用
- MySQL实战系列1:生产标准线上环境安装配置
- Samba 系列(七):在 Samba AD DC 服务器上创建共享目录并映射到 Windows/Linux 客户
- Samba 系列(二):在 Linux 命令行下管理 Samba4 AD 架构
- LFCS 系列第十一讲:如何使用命令 vgcreate、lvcreate 和 lvextend 管理和创建 LVM
- memcached系列之二
- JavaScript进阶系列03,通过硬编码、工厂模式、构造函数创建JavaScript对象
- Jenkins系列之四——设置邮件通知
- Code First开发系列之管理数据库创建,填充种子数据以及LINQ操作详解
- iOS开发系列--音频播放、录音、视频播放、拍照、视频录制
- flutter系列之:创建一个内嵌的navigation
- netty系列之:手持framecodec神器,创建多路复用http2客户端
- webpack高级概念,webpack与浏览器的缓存,打包文件hash命名(系列九)
- vue3中readonly家族(系列十二)
- 数据库综合系列 之 基本表的创建和增删改查
- 算法补天系列之——前缀树+贪心算法